Englahd akdWALES Ap. = April All other dates .are in May. I iMap only indicates first arrivals. .; iin each locality. 167 THE LAND-RAIL. Cre.r pratensis Bechst. There were very few records o£ this species, especially fromthe southern, south-eastern and eastern counties. The lighthouses furnish only a single record, one birdhavino- been killed at Start Point at 2 A.M. on the 15th ofMa)-, at the tail end of an enormous flight of six or moredifferent species. The first arrival noted was in Surrey on the 10th of April,and on the 17th one v:as heard in the Isle of Man. Subse-quently birds were recorded from Cornwall and Wilts on the22nd, from Somerset, Lancashire and Norfolk on the 23rd,from Worcester on the 26th, from Lincoln on the 27th, fromLeicester, Norfolk, Yorkshire and Nottingham on the 29th,from Cheshire on the 4th of May and from Cumberland onthe 5th.
